Notice to Vacate Information

Required Notice Period

According to New Zealand tenancy law and your rental agreement, you must provide:

  • Fixed-term tenancies: Notice to vacate at the end of a fixed term should be given at least 21 days before the end date.
  • Periodic tenancies: At least 21 days' written notice is required.

Failing to provide adequate notice may result in additional rent charges.

Move-Out Checklist

To ensure a smooth move-out process and maximize your bond refund, please complete the following checklist before vacating:

Cleaning

  • Thoroughly clean all rooms, including floors, walls, and windows
  • Clean kitchen appliances inside and out
  • Clean and sanitize bathroom fixtures
  • Remove all personal items from drawers and storage areas
  • Vacuum and clean carpets

Utilities & Services

  • Transfer or disconnect utilities (electricity, gas, water)
  • Provide forwarding address for mail
  • Cancel or transfer internet service
  • Return all keys, access cards, and remotes

Final Inspection

  • Schedule final inspection with property manager
  • Take photos of clean, vacated property
  • Complete property condition report
  • Provide bank details for bond refund
